How Bayern Munich may line up against Tottenham Hotspur

Ahead of Wednesday's Champions League fixture between Bayern Munich and Spurs, Sports Mole looks at how the German side could line up against the Premier League outfit.

Bayern Munich play host to Tottenham Hotspur on Wednesday night looking to maintain their 100% record in this season's Champions League.

The Bundesliga giants have recorded five successive victories in Group B, which has given them an unassailable lead over their next opponents.

However, with Bayern having suffered two straight defeats in Germany's top flight, Hans Flick may take the opportunity to rest players against the Premier League outfit.

Here, Sports Mole predicts how the Bavarians may line up for the fixture at the Allianz Arena.


Out: Niklas Sule (knee), Lucas Hernandez (ankle), Fiete Arp (arm), Mickael Cuisance (foot)
Doubtful: Corentin Tolisso (thigh), Jerome Boateng (calf)

Despite having sustained calf and thigh issues against Borussia Monchengladbach at the weekend, Jerome Boateng and Corentin Tolisso should be available for this fixture.

However, having been in line to start against Spurs, Mickael Cuisance has been ruled out after picking up a foot injury.

The absence of the Frenchman could lead to Joshua Kimmich, Tolisso and Philippe Coutinho forming a three-man midfield, with Ivan Perisic, Kingsley Coman and Serge Gnabry being used further forward.

That would allow Thiago, Leon Goretzka and Robert Lewandowski to drop down to the substitutes' bench ahead of Saturday's meeting with Werder Bremen.

Due to being sidelined through suspension at the weekend, Javi Martinez should feature at the back, with Benjamin Pavard coming into the starting lineup at right-back.

Sven Ulreich is expected to take the place of Manuel Neuer between the sticks.
